SUMMARY:Monkeyface
DESCRIPTION:Set within the cramped confines of a university bedroom\, Monkeyface explores the euphoric highs and devastating lows of Freshers Week\, toxic friendships\, club culture\, and the universal quest for connection. \nWhat starts with familiar themes—flatmates\, cliques\, and the chaotic excitement of queer nightlife—gradually evolves into a raw and intimate portrait of a young Black queer student striving to survive in a world that was not built to support him.

SUMMARY:MOFFIE
DESCRIPTION:Seventeen-year-old Nicholas van der Swart is conscripted into the South African Defence Force and is thrust into a regime that demands unwavering conformity\, aggressive masculinity\, and promotes racism and bigotry. \n“MOFFIE” unfolds against the backdrop of apartheid South Africa\, following Nicholas’s struggle against societal expectations and his internal battle to find his own identity amidst the violence of South Africa’s border war from 1966 to 1989. \nThe play delves into the fear of being labeled a ‘moffie’—a derogatory term for being gay—and the constant threat of exposure. “MOFFIE” is an exploration of toxic masculinity and trauma\, shedding light on how the emotional wounds inflicted during those turbulent times continue to affect South Africa even 30 years into democracy\, serving as a poignant reminder of the lasting impact of the past on the present and future.
